    Quote Originally Posted by DMCNI View Post


    What is the fixture & fitting with the DMC logo in the back ground? And what became of them when the factory closed and do any exist today?
    This is likely to be the curing oven. The structure is 100 feet in length. You can just see the lozenge shape entry at the far end of the structure. The black bodies were conveyed on a moving track. The photograph was taken during the start-up phase of the company the oven was unlikely to be operating at the time of the photograph. I’ll get confirmation of these facts later this week – If I’m wrong I’ll let you know – but I believe I am correct. The oven – as with all other factory contents was sold in the factory auction organised by the liquidators Henry Butcher and sons.
